/// Compresses all responses with Brotli or Gzip compression.
///
/// Compression is done in the same manner as the [`Compress`](super::Compress)
/// responder.
///
/// By default, the fairing does not compress responses with a `Content-Type`
/// matching any of the following:
///
/// - `application/gzip`
/// - `application/zip`
/// - `image/*`
/// - `video/*`
/// - `application/octet-stream`
/// - `text/event-stream`
///
/// # Usage
///
/// Attach the compression [fairing](/rocket/fairing/) to your Rocket
/// application:
///
/// ```rust
/// use rocket_async_compression::Compression;
///
///
/// rocket::build()
///     // ...
///     .attach(Compression::fairing())
///     // ...
///     # ;
///
/// ```
pub struct Compression {
    pub level: Level,
    pub excluded_content_types: Vec<MediaType>,
}

/// Compresses all responses with Brotli or Gzip compression. Caches compressed
/// response bodies in memory for selected file types/path suffixes, useful for
/// compressing large compiled JS/CSS files, OTF font packs, etc.  Note that all
/// cached files are held in memory indefinitely.
///
/// Compression is done in the same manner as the [`Compression`](Compression)
/// fairing.
///
/// # Usage
///
/// Attach the compression [fairing](/rocket/fairing/) to your Rocket
/// application:
///
/// ```rust
/// use rocket_async_compression::CachedCompression;
///
/// rocket::build()
///     // ...
///     .attach(CachedCompression {
///         cached_paths: vec![
///             "".to_owned(),
///             "/".to_owned(),
///             "/about".to_owned(),
///             "/people".to_owned(),
///             "/posts".to_owned(),
///             "/events".to_owned(),
///             "/groups".to_owned(),
///         ],
///         cached_path_prefixes: vec!["/user/".to_owned(), "/g/".to_owned(), "/p/".to_owned()],
///         cached_path_suffixes: vec![".otf".to_owned(), "main.dart.js".to_owned()],
///         ..Default::default()
///     })
///     // ...
/// ```
///
///
#[derive(Default)]
pub struct CachedCompression {
    pub cached_paths: Vec<String>,
    pub cached_path_prefixes: Vec<String>,
    pub cached_path_suffixes: Vec<String>,
    pub excluded_path_prefixes: Vec<String>,
    pub level: Option<Level>,
}
